This is a helpful and informative book, but not very interesting or engaging enough for a child. I would have to read it over many times for the tools in it to be useful to my kids. ( ) The main message of this book is how to cope with anger, and that it is okay to be angry sometimes! I felt that the language in this book was clear and concise, and explained anger in a way that very young children could understand and relate to. Although the writing was in short sentences with only 1-2 sentences per page, it was still very descriptive. The author did a wonderful job of providing examples or situations that would make someone angry. There is the main character of a bunny, but this character is not really developed and simply serves as an example of how to handle anger that children can relate to. The plot was organized, and the story had a good flow to it. The illustrations of this book are beautiful. They were colored with colored pencil and you can really see the emotion in the characters faces even though they are animals. This book pushes readers to think about more uncomfortable feelings like anger and coping with our emotions.
